Kalliope wrote:There's multiple stages of activation today.

First, the bit of patch that needs to download goes on your comp.

Once there, it hooks up with your previously-downloaded bits of patch and starts to install. This part takes a while.

Then you get the SHINY NEW Cataclysm launcher splash screen. Once there, you have about 1.4 gig worth of data to download. Since it's the Cata launcher, you'll actually be able to get in before it finishes downloading, but with the servers still down, you might as well let it finish.
You should always let it finish anyway. Playing with some files incomplete is a plain bad idea.
